Weather is the condition of the atmosphere at a particular place and time. It includes temperature, sunshine, rain, wind, clouds, snow, and other atmospheric conditions.
Weather is what the air and sky are like outside. It can be sunny, rainy, cloudy, windy, hot, or cold.
Example sentence:
The weather is sunny today, so we can play outside.

A hotel is a building where people pay to stay for a short time. It provides rooms for sleeping and may also offer services such as food, housekeeping, Wi-Fi, a reception desk, and other facilities for guests.

Here are some easy airport vocabulary sentences for English learners:
👉Airport – I arrived at the airport two hours before my flight.
👉Passport – Please show your passport at the check-in desk.
👉Ticket – I bought my plane ticket online.
👉Check-in – We checked in our luggage before boarding.
👉Boarding pass – The boarding pass tells you your seat number.
👉Luggage – My luggage is very heavy.
👉Suitcase – She packed her clothes in a large suitcase.
👉Security – Everyone must go through security.
👉Gate – Our flight leaves from Gate 12.
👉Departure – The departure time is 9:30 a.m.
👉Arrival – The arrival time is 11:45 a.m.
👉Flight – Our flight was delayed by one hour.
👉Pilot – The pilot welcomed everyone on the plane.
👉Flight attendant – The flight attendant served drinks to the passengers.
👉Passenger – Every passenger must wear a seat belt.
👉Boarding – Boarding starts 30 minutes before departure.
👉Customs – We went through customs after landing.
👉Immigration – The immigration officer checked my passport.
👉Runway – The airplane took off from the runway.
👉Terminal – We waited for our friends in Terminal 1.

A phrasal verb is a combination of a verb + one or two small words (called particles, such as up, on, off, out, or into). Together, they create a meaning that is often different from the original verb.
Examples
Wake up = stop sleeping
I wake up at 7:00 every morning.
Turn on = start a machine or device
Please turn on the TV.
Turn off = stop a machine or device
Turn off the lights before you leave.
Look after = take care of
She looks after her little brother.
Give up = stop trying or quit
Don't give up. Keep working hard!
Pick up = lift or collect
Please pick up the book.
Tips
Phrasal verbs are very common in everyday English.
Their meaning is not always obvious from the individual words, so it's best to learn them as complete expressions.
Practice them in sentences to remember them more easily
